摘要
The present research proposes a comprehensive model to determine the retailer strategy for purchasing electrical power from the wholesale and/or local market in an active distribution network. The uncertainties associated with the load and distributed generation resources in the active distribution network, wholesale market price, and behavior of the local market players were all incorporated into the presented model. The demand response program benefits the retailers in governing the risks. A risk-based decision-making scheme was established in this paper that considered every instrument accessible to retailers and the uncertainties involved. The major objective of this paper is to maximize the retailer benefit concerning a tolerable risk. In order to model risks, scenario theories were exploited and Particle Swarm Optimization (PSO) was employed to solve the optimization problem. The proposed scheme was simulated in an actual network, and the obtained results confirmed the effectiveness and computability of this method.
